All Club Members - Please Read

Hello All,

Following the last Committee meeting called to discuss the subs, the following information was decided upon:

Subs and Club Income/Expenditure

Essentially, the Club income from last year was £2000 down. This was due to increase in costs, some Club expenditure and less money raised through fundraising. You are able to view the full breakdown of accounts on Pitchero from the AGM. This imbalance needs addressing and with essential requirements for investment and development, it is imperative that Subs go up in order to address this issue. If we continue as we are, there will be no Club in a few years. Therefore an annual payment package has been set up to include payment for match fees, subs and training fees which if option 1 is your membership of choice, it saves you £40 across the season (please see the breakdown below) and allows for all match fees to be paid in advance and in one go, or in 4 separate direct debit payments. This hugely assists the Clubs budget requirements and allows for future investment. All payments are to be made either by BACS or via Pitchero.

Pay-As-You-Play
For those who will be playing less frequently there is a Pay-as-you-Play plan as below.

Covers:
Annual membership Fees and training

Upfront cost of £100
Payment of £10 to be made for each game played

Family Membership - one adult and two children

We are currently looking at discount options for family membership and will post these on Pitchero as soon as it’s decided upon.

Students and Unemployed
For those who are students or unemployed, annual subs are £50.
Match fees are £5
